38 END
39 {
40 # Nobody ever checks the status of print()s. That's okay, because
41 # if any do fail, we're guaranteed to get an indicator when we close()
42 # the filehandle.
43 #
44 # Close stdout now, and if there were no errors, return happy status.
45 # If stdout has already been closed by the script, though, do nothing.
46 defined fileno STDOUT
47 or return;
48 close STDOUT
49 and return;
50
51 # Errors closing stdout. Indicate that, and hope stderr is OK.
52 warn "$ME: closing standard output: $!\n";
53
54 # Don't be so arrogant as to assume that we're the first END handler
55 # defined, and thus the last one invoked. There may be others yet
56 # to come. $? will be passed on to them, and to the final _exit().
57 #
58 # If it isn't already an error, make it one (and if it _is_ an error,
59 # preserve the value: it might be important).
60 $? ||= 1;
61 }

469 print <<EOF;
470
471 [*] You can use either of the above signature files to verify that
472 the corresponding file (without the .sig suffix) is intact. First,
473 be sure to download both the .sig file and the corresponding tarball.
474 Then, run a command like this:
475
476 gpg --verify $tgz.sig
477
478 If that command fails because you don't have the required public key,
479 then run this command to import it:
480
481 gpg --keyserver keys.gnupg.net --recv-keys $gpg_key_id
482
483 and rerun the \`gpg --verify' command.
484 EOF
